From d77e38e612a017480157fe6d2c1422f42cb5b7e3 Mon Sep 17 00:00:00 2001 From: Steffen Klassert Date: Fri, 14 Apr 2017 10:06:10 +0200 Subject: xfrm: Add an IPsec hardware offloading API This patch adds all the bits that are needed to do IPsec hardware offload for IPsec states and ESP packets. We add xfrmdev_ops to the net_device. xfrmdev_ops has function pointers that are needed to manage the xfrm states in the hardware and to do a per packet offloading decision.
